-#ifndef __GETCGI_H_
-#define __GETCGI_H_
-
-/**
- * txt2html - Takes a string and converts it to HTML.
- * @string: The string to HTMLize.
- *
- * Takes a string and escapes any HTML entities.
- */
-char *txt2html(const char *string);
-
-/*
- * start_html - Start HTML output.
- * @title: The title for the HTML.
- *
- * Takes a title string and starts HTML output, including the
- * Content-Type header all the way up to <BODY>.
- */
-void start_html(const char *title);
-
-/*
- * end_html - End HTML output.
- *
- * Ends HTML output - closes the BODY and HTML tags.
- */
-void end_html(void);
-
-char x2c(const char *what);
-void unescape_url(char *url);
-char **getcgivars(int argc, char *argv[]);
-
-/**
- * cleanupcgi - free the memory allocated for our CGI parameters.
- * @cgivars: The CGI parameter list to free.
- *
- * Frees up the elements of the CGI parameter array and then frees the
- * array.
- */
-void cleanupcgi(char **cgivars);
-
-#endif /* __GETCGI_H_ */
